Armaan Yadav (artist name: K!LLSWITCH) is a music journalist and rapper-producer based in New Delhi, India. His journalism is primarily focused on reporting and dissecting hip-hop news within the hip-hop subcultures in India and the United States. Words in HipHop'n'More, Rolling Stone India, FTC and more.

